Historical Note Hollywood Regency lighting flourished from the 1960s through the 1980s, blending classical European influences with glamorous materials including brass, crystal, marble, and polished metals. Crystal urn lamps inspired by French Empire and Maison Charles designs became staples of upscale interiors, while palm leaf finials and neoclassical detailing reflected the luxury aesthetic popularized by designers such as John Richard and Chapman. Today these vintage crystal and brass lamps remain highly sought after for traditional, Palm Beach, French Country, and Hollywood Regency interiors. Estimated Value 350-650
